What can I do to improve the speed of my broadband?
There's a lot of things that can affect the speed of your broadband. From how for your property is from the telephone exchange to where you keep your router.
Below we have a few top tips to help you get the best speeds possible.
Use the Master socket:
This will reduce the risk of interference from any extension sockets you have.
Check Micro-filters:
These filter the phone and broadband signal on your phone line to maximise speed and stability of your connection.
Clear your cache:
It's important to keep your web browser in top condition, you may also find it useful to close and programmes/applications that you're not using. You can find out how to clear your cache
Too many devices:
Using lots of different computers, tablets, smartphones or gaming devices connected to the internet at the same time, will slow down your broadband speed.
Protect your devices from viruses:
It's vital that you keep your computer protected with up to date internet security software and run regular anti-virus scans.
